Thanks for the feedback guys, here's what I'm calling final:

 

WindowB2005.jpg

 

I think the composition reads a little better this way . . . or it could just be because it's different than what I'd been staring at for six years.

 

Fixed the light leak on the table in A:M, tweaked a few little things in Photopaint, including a few subtle pieces of floating dust. Stopped the render at 21 passes because it looked good enough, and because I needed my computer back :) render time on this one at 1280x960 was 12-ish hours, but I increased a few of the radiosity settings more than I probably needed to.

 

As for how to work with heavy scenes like this, it's actually pretty painless to do preview renders if you keep the settings low while you work. It only takes about 15 seconds to throw 80,000 photos around the scene, and with final gathering samples set to minimum, I can do progressive renders pretty quickly.

Hey Brian,

 

That looks really good. I, too prefer that one to the old one. Lot more moody.

 

I see two areas where a tweak would help:

 

1) The light leak under the table could be taken care of with two methods: a) The right way is to increase the sampling area size. But at some point, you would need to increase the number of photons too. B) Another way is to cheat a little and set the radiance of the patches under the table to some lower value.

 

2) The Photon Mapping algorithm does not store photons on their first hit. That means that the spots where the sun directly hits the table top, the wall, the floor and the chair, do not contribute to the indirect illumination while they should contribute the most. There is a simple way to correct that. It is to use a special light rig, two klieg light back to back used as sun. One is pointing in the room and the other is pointing on a mirror that reflects the photons back in the room. And since the first hit in on the mirror, the wall, table top, etc will store the photons. I have designed such a rig and you can find it in the following thread:

So how do you stop a render and keep the image it's rendered so far?

If you can fit the whole thing on screen, just hit printscrn and paste into your favorite image editor. Do it before you abort the render though, as A:M seems to occassionally empty the frame buffer and hide the image when you abort a multipass (I wish it didn't).
